How can it be cruel if it is in the Bible?
This is what I was sent:
Psalm 88 is a psalm of despair. It is written by the “Sons of Korah” and describes the writer’s feeling of frustration and abandonment. In fact, the ONLY positive note is the first line- “LORD, you are the God who saves me. “
I think it may be helpful to realize that there have been other good men who have pleaded with God, and who have felt that their prayers were not being heard or answered. But yet God chose for this psalm to be included in His Book of Life.
So I think that the purpose is to show us that even God’s chosen children have to suffer, and to show that we ARE allowed to pour out our feelings to God and He will not be angry at us for our weakness. Never give up praying, even if you are having a hard time thinking of anything positive to say.
